Transaction 7066a4c747e501c1324310c2d5e161690ef0a68195933ad426027a9177e8525e
1 Input
1 Output
-
7066a4c747e501c1324310c2d5e161690ef0a68195933ad426027a9177e8525e:0
- value
- 1520991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8233fdd77d2842081c2fa1e009022fe0ff6b985 OP_EQUAL
- address
- 3MPr79yC5522fxDLAicGBqnwqx4g3LUdJS